Abstract

The utility model discloses an integrated electrocoagulation flushing and sucking device, comprising a tee provided with an electrocoagulation port, a water inlet and a negative pressure suction port, wherein the tee is also provided with a tee control switch; one end of a water pipe is connected with the electrocoagulation port; an electrocoagulation joint is arranged on the water pipe; an insulation electrocoagulation bar which is connected with an electrocoagulation hook shrink control switch is located in the water pipe; an electrocoagulation hook is connected with the insulation electrocoagulation bar and is located at the top end of the water pipe; the electrocoagulation joint is also provided with an electrocoagulation pedal joint connected with an electrocoagulation pedal; a flushing pipe is connected with the water inlet; the negative pressure suction port is connected with a negative pressure suction pump. According to the integrated electrocoagulation flushing and sucking device, the telescopic electrocoagulation hook and a flushing and sucking device are of an integrated structure; practicability, convenience and rapidness are realized in the surgery process; electrocoagulation hemostasis is carried out while a wound surface is flushed and sucked; when electrocoagulation is not needed, the electrocoagulation hook is retracted into the water pipe, the tissue is protected, the surgery process is simplified, the surgery time is shortened, and the surgery efficiency is improved.

Background technology
At present, often can use suction pump to rinse and attract after wound surface when carrying out laparoscopic surgery, change coagulation and hook hemostasis, laparoscopic surgery apparatus used is more special, and changing apparatus needs the regular hour, more loaded down with trivial details, has extended operating time.In addition, in changing apparatus process, wound surface has again new oozing of blood, not only affects surgical field of view, has affected electric coagulation hemostasis effect simultaneously.
